Best Areas to Rent Office Space in Nairobi

Different business districts cater to different industries and budgets. Choosing the right location depends on your target clients, operational needs, and company size.

Westlands

Westlands has become one of Nairobi’s premier commercial hubs and is home to numerous multinational companies, financial institutions, technology firms, and professional service providers.

Businesses choose Westlands because of:

  • Modern Grade A office buildings
  • Excellent road connectivity
  • High-end restaurants and hotels
  • Shopping centres
  • Reliable internet infrastructure
  • Professional business environment

Westlands is ideal for corporate headquarters, consulting firms, technology companies, and regional offices.

Upper Hill

Upper Hill is one of Nairobi’s fastest-growing business districts.

It is particularly popular with:

  • Banks
  • Insurance companies
  • International organizations
  • Law firms
  • Financial institutions
  • Healthcare companies

Many office developments feature:

  • High-speed lifts
  • Backup generators
  • Ample parking
  • Modern conference facilities
  • Advanced security systems

Upper Hill is an excellent choice for businesses seeking a prestigious corporate address.

Nairobi CBD

The Central Business District remains one of Kenya’s busiest commercial locations.

Office users include:

  • Government agencies
  • Retail businesses
  • Financial institutions
  • SMEs
  • Legal firms
  • Professional service providers

Advantages include:

  • Excellent public transport
  • High business visibility
  • Large customer base
  • Convenient access to government offices

Although traffic congestion can be challenging, the CBD remains an important business location.

Kilimani

Kilimani has evolved into a mixed-use neighborhood combining residential developments with modern commercial buildings.

The area is popular among:

  • Startups
  • Creative agencies
  • Medical practices
  • Marketing firms
  • Technology companies

Its growing business community and modern office spaces make it attractive for expanding businesses.

Gigiri

Gigiri is internationally recognised for hosting diplomatic missions, the United Nations Office at Nairobi (UNON), and numerous international organizations.

Businesses operating in Gigiri include:

  • NGOs
  • International agencies
  • Diplomatic support services
  • Consultancy firms
  • Security companies

The neighborhood offers a secure, professional environment with premium office developments.

Grade A vs Grade B Office Buildings

Understanding the differences between office classifications can help you choose a workspace that matches your budget and business requirements.

Grade A Offices

Grade A offices usually offer:

  • Prime business locations
  • Modern construction
  • Energy-efficient systems
  • Premium interior finishes
  • Professional reception areas
  • High-speed lifts
  • Large parking facilities
  • Excellent building management

These offices are ideal for companies that frequently host clients or require a prestigious corporate image.

Grade B Offices

Grade B office buildings are generally more affordable while still providing functional workspaces.

They typically offer:

  • Good accessibility
  • Standard office layouts
  • Basic security systems
  • Reliable utilities
  • Competitive rental rates

These offices are well suited to startups, SMEs, and businesses seeking quality office space within a manageable budget.

Additional Business Costs to Consider

Monthly rent is only one component of the overall cost of occupying office space.

Business owners should also budget for:

  • Service charges
  • Internet services
  • Electricity
  • Water
  • Cleaning services
  • Security fees
  • Office maintenance
  • Parking charges
  • Business permits
  • Office insurance

Understanding these recurring expenses allows businesses to prepare realistic operating budgets.

Inspect the Building

Before signing a lease, inspect the property thoroughly.

Check:

  • Air conditioning systems
  • Internet connectivity
  • Electrical installations
  • Backup power
  • Water supply
  • Lift operation
  • Washroom facilities
  • Fire safety equipment
  • Security arrangements
  • Parking availbility

A comprehensive inspection helps identify any issues before occupying the premises.

Review the Lease Carefully

Commercial leases often include important clauses regarding:

  • Rent reviews
  • Service charges
  • Maintenance responsibilities
  • Office alterations
  • Renewal options
  • Termination procedures

Read the agreement carefully and seek legal advice if necessary before signing.
